图书介绍

监控组态软件的设计与开发【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

监控组态软件的设计与开发
  • 李建伟,郭宏编著 著
  • 出版社: 北京:冶金工业出版社
  • ISBN:7502443258
  • 出版时间:2007
  • 标注页数:170页
  • 文件大小:16MB
  • 文件页数:180页
  • 主题词:C语言-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

监控组态软件的设计与开发P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 组态系统概述1

1.1 组态软件简介1

1.1.1 监控系统的发展过程1

1.1.2 组态软件的产生与特点4

1.1.3 组态软件的现状5

1.1.4 组态软件的发展趋势7

1.2 组态软件的结构9

1.2.1 以使用软件的工作阶段划分9

1.2.2 按照成员构成划分10

1.2.3 组态软件的数据处理流程12

1.2.4 组态软件的特点12

1.2.5 组态软件的性能13

1.2.6 组态软件在监控系统中的地位14

1.3 组态软件的开发环境14

1.3.1 组态软件开发环境的选择14

1.3.2 组态软件的一般使用步骤15

第2章 开发工具简介16

2.1 Visual C++6.0的开发环境16

2.1.1 开发环境简介17

2.1.2 MFC类库介绍21

2.2 MFC类库的基本类结构36

2.2.1 CObject类37

2.2.2 应用程序结构类37

2.2.3 可视对象类39

2.2.4 绘图打印类41

2.2.5 文件和数据库类42

2.2.6 Internet和网络类43

2.3 利用AppWizard创建程序框架44

2.3.1 运行AppWizard(应用程序向导)44

2.3.2 选择MFC AppWizard(exe)图标44

2.3.3 程序界面选择44

2.3.4 数据库支持46

2.3.5 OLE和ActiveX支持47

2.3.6 用户界面特征选择48

2.3.7 使用MFC库49

2.3.8 类和文件名51

第3章 组态软件总体结构设计51

3.1 组态软件需求分析53

3.2 系统的面向对象分析55

3.2.1 面向对象技术55

3.2.2 组态软件的面向对象模型分析56

3.2.3 组态软件运行的层次分析59

3.2.4 组态软件设计思路61

3.3 系统的总体结构设计61

3.3.1 图形组态模块62

3.3.2 实时数据库模块63

3.3.3 设备驱动和通讯管理模块64

第4章 图形组态模块的实现64

4.1 图形组态的发展与功能概述65

4.1.1 图形组态系统的发展65

4.1.2 图形组态系统的功能66

4.2 图元类设计66

4.2.1 图元类概述66

4.2.2 图元类库的层次划分67

4.3 绘图程序相关的主要类及函数68

4.3.1 视图类68

4.3.2 CDocument类及成员函数73

4.3.3 CDC类及成员函数80

4.3.4 CDialog类及成员函数84

4.4 基本图元的实现94

4.4.1 基本图元总体设计方案94

4.4.2 基本图元类的实现94

4.4.3 基本图元类的文件方式保存与打开96

4.5 成组图元类的实现98

4.5.1 成组图元数据成员100

4.5.2 成组图元类的方法100

4.6 动态图元类的实现100

4.7 图符库的实现102

第5章 实时数据库模块的设计与实现102

5.1 数据库系统的发展趋势105

5.2 实时数据库简介106

5.2.1 实时系统106

5.2.2 实时数据库系统107

5.2.3 实时数据库系统的一致性108

5.3 实时事务特性109

5.3.1 事务与任务109

5.3.2 实时数据库事务的应用分析109

5.3.3 实时事务的定时限制111

5.3.4 实时事务的正确性111

5.4 实时数据库分析112

5.4.1 实时数据库功能分析112

5.4.2 实时数据库结构分析112

5.5 实时数据库设计与实现114

5.5.1 实时数据库的面向对象分析114

5.5.2 实时数据类的实现115

5.5.3 数据字典的保存116

5.5.4 实时数据在内存中的存储方案117

第6章 历史数据库组态119

6.1 数据库基础知识119

6.1.1 关系数据库的概念120

6.1.2 SQL语言简介122

6.2 ODBC简介125

6.2.1 ODBC125

6.2.2 配置ODBC数据源126

6.3 数据库编程131

6.3.1 分配ODBC环境131

6.3.2 分配连接句柄132

6.3.3 连接数据源132

6.3.4 SQL操作136

6.3.5 断开同数据源的连接145

6.3.6 释放ODBC环境145

6.3.7 ODBC API编程总结145

第7章 设备通讯驱动模块145

7.1 设备驱动程序功能简介146

7.2 设备驱动程序组态方案147

7.2.1 不同类型设备的驱动程序库设计147

7.2.2 DDE技术的概述及实现148

7.3 通讯接口150

7.3.1 串行通讯接口的实现150

7.3.2 TCP/IP通讯协议的实现164

参考文献170

热门推荐